Garys is a variant of Gary, which originates from the Old English element 'gar' meaning 'spear' combined with 'ric' meaning 'ruler' or 'powerful.' Historically, it was used to denote a brave warrior or leader armed with a spear. The name gained popularity in English-speaking countries during the 20th century as a modern adaptation of traditional Germanic roots.

Cultural Significance of Garys

The name Garys, as a variation of Gary, carries the cultural significance of strength and leadership rooted in Old English and Germanic traditions. It symbolizes a warrior spirit and governance, making it a favored choice among those valuing heritage and valor. The name was especially popular in mid-20th century Western cultures, reflecting a trend towards strong, concise masculine names.

Gary Cooper

American film actor known for his natural, authentic style and starring roles in classic Westerns.

Garry Kasparov

World Chess Champion and political activist, considered one of the greatest chess players in history.

Gary Powers

American pilot shot down over Soviet airspace during the Cold War, known for the U-2 incident.
